Postby Dennis » Sat Oct 07, 2017 12:52 pm

We do not utilize pop-up ads on this site (I hate them too). It would be rare for one to slip past Google Adsense, however, If you do find one, PM me all the info you can and I'll block it if possible.

Also, if you are experiencing popup ads, they could come from other sites you have visited before Farmallcub.com, rogue browser plug-ins, malware, etc. Try a reputable malware and anti-virus scanner to clean things up.

Dennis

PS: The most ads you should ever see on one page (besides the sponsors) is three, and that is only if you are not logged into the site. Otherwise it is two.

Postby John *.?-!.* cub owner » Tue Oct 10, 2017 1:37 pm

Do not believe that because you have an I-phone you do not need an antivirus. For years Apple claimed that there were no viruses on their products, but it was because they had such a small share of the market no one bothered to write them. With I-Phones becoming very popular viruses are now being written specifically to attack them. So far the most common ones I have heard of were location specific ads, but the software to trigger it was installed in the phone when visiting another site. it may trigger due to your location as reported by your built in GPS, or as to a site you visit regularly and it comes on then.
